The Director of IT SOX Controls serves as the primary bridge between IT and the company's SOX compliance function. Embedded within IT, this role champions a culture of controls awareness across IT, driving best practices, training activities, and ongoing monitoring of the day-to-day execution of IT SOX activities, ensuring IT is always audit-ready.This is a hands-on leadership role that requires both technical knowledge and strong business acumen — someone who speaks fluent IT and fluent SOX audit, and can act as a trusted advisor to IT leadership on SOX-related matters and proactively communicate risks and status.
How You’ll Spend Your Day
- Translate Corporate SOX policies into IT-specific technical standards and control requirements
- Act as the key liaison between IT and Corporate SOX function, as well as external auditors, developing trusted relationships with the audit teams
- Partner with Corporate SOX team to align on scope, timelines, and methodology for each annual audit
- Serve as the primary point of contact for all IT internal and external SOX audits
- Continuously evaluate the IT SOX controls environment, identify opportunities to streamline, automate, and improve controls, and introduce AI to improve control execution, monitoring, and evidence collection
- Develop monitoring processes and dashboards showing real-time compliance status
- Own the controls deficiencies remediation tracking process. Work with control owners to design and implement corrective action plans, and report progress to Corporate SOX function and IT leadership
- Work with process owners and control owners to ensure policies are understood, embedded into workflows, and consistently followed
- Develop and deliver ongoing training programs for IT staff at all levels - IT leadership, SPOCs, and control owners
Your Skills and Experience
- 7+ years of combined experience in IT audit, IT risk, IT compliance, or a related field
- Deep knowledge of IT General Controls (access management, change management, computer operations, SDLC) and IT Application Controls
- Prior experience in a publicly traded company SOX environment or auditor experience from one of the Big 4
